Sarat Chandra Chattopadhyay’s 1917 novel Devdas has acquired an almost mythical status in India, having been adapted for the screen a record twenty times in multiple languages since the first silent film version in 1928. 

Sanjay Leela Bhansali’s adaptation is a sumptuously mounted romantic period drama with opulent sets, luxurious costumes, and spectacular choreography that tells the tragic tale of star-crossed lovers Devdas (Shah Rukh Khan) and Paro (Aishwarya Rai) on a grand operatic scale. 

Childhood sweethearts, Devdas and Paro’s plans to marry are rebuffed by Devdas’s wealthy family. In retaliation, Paro’s family arranges her marriage to an older aristocrat while a heartbroken Devdas leaves his home and descends into alcoholism, finding solace with a warm-hearted courtesan (Madhuri Dixit).
